Emma Miran

Emma will serve as a planning and development coordinator between the Town of Stonington and the Stonington Opera House, sharing her planning skills and experience in digital communications.  Some of her goals include creating and sustaining a supportive and positive climate for year-round businesses; researching the potential for an industrial park; acting as a small business consultant for the Town's microloan program; templating and refining websites; researching and coordinating public funding opportunities; and, researching potential collaborations with private, state and federal programs.

Emma comes from Waverly, New York.  She received her B.S. in Applied Economics and Management in 2007 from Cornell University and recently completed an internship with Crist Brothers' Orchard, working primarily with logistics, office management and customer relations.  She received training with a focus on financial services and credit in the Career Development Program at First Pioneer Farm Credit.  During college, she tutored at Corning Community College's Writing Center and worked as a lifeguard for the Red Cross Swimming Program in Waverly, New York.  Emma participated in an Emerging Markets Field Study Program, where her field study consisted of dealing with developing a marketing plan for locally grown produce in South Carolina coastal communities.
